well it all looks pretty str84ward under there. bit of wire jiggery pokery aside. but what on earth happens with the seat lock cable? how does it reattach, just rout chopped cable elsewhere?

I had the same concern when I chopped the tail off mine. All I ended up doing was rerouting the metal 'noodle' that goes to the catch so instead of the cable coming from around the tail, it simply sits under the seat instead (comes in from the opposite direction).
